How much do hilton com j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for hilton com in the United States is $26.45,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.46 and $30.53 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Hilton Communications Spec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Hilton Communications Specialist, you need strong written and verbal communication skills, a background in public relations or marketing, and usually a bachelor's degree in communications or a related field. Familiarity with content management systems (CMS), media monitoring tools, and social media platforms is typically necessary. Creativity, adaptability, and strong interpersonal skills help you craft effective messages and build relationships with internal and external stakeholders. These skills are essential for protecting Hilton's brand reputation and ensuring consistent, clear messaging across all channels.

What are Hilton Com jobs?

Hilton Com jobs typically refer to positions related to Hilton's Commercial team, which includes roles in sales, marketing, revenue management, and customer relations. These professionals work to drive business growth, manage client relationships, and maximize hotel revenue through strategic planning and marketing initiatives. Hilton Com employees often collaborate across departments to deliver exceptional guest experiences and achieve company goals. Career opportunities in this area can range from entry-level sales support to senior leadership positions in commercial strategy.

What are the most common challenges faced by team members working at Hilton Com, and how can new hires prepare for them?

Team members at Hilton Com often encounter challenges related to maintaining high standards of guest service while managing a fast-paced and dynamic environment. New hires can prepare by developing strong communication skills, learning to prioritize tasks efficiently, and being adaptable to changing guest needs and operational requirements. Collaborating closely with colleagues from different departments is also key to ensuring smooth operations and delivering exceptional guest experiences. Regular training and a supportive team structure help new employees acclimate quickly and thrive in their roles.
